Russell Simmons, RUSH Philanthropic and Bombay Sapphire Gin To Host 6th Artisan Series Grand Finale in Miami
The Simmons Family is heading down to Miami this winter to partake in the 2015 Art Basel festivities. Through The Bombay Sapphire Artisan Series program, launched in 2010 as a collaboration between Russell & Danny Simmons’ RUSH Philanthropic Arts Foundation and Bombay Sapphire Gin, Simmons & Co. will conduct a nationwide search for the next big names in visual arts with a focus on fostering the talents of emerging and underrepresented artists.
